Default Re: New Stebel 300 Hz Truck Horn

Quote:
Originally Posted by THESKILZ View Post
Well since they are all wired independently i used 16 ga.; as wire using dc volts can handle more amperage ..Works fine

with 16 gauge, don't go over 6 feet of wire length. i'd suggest that anyone doing this use 12-14 gauge wire. i used 12, but after replacing so many headlight wiring harnesses and other burnt wiring for idiots who bring their cars/trucks to my buddy's shop, i never skimp on wiring.
